Clinical and hemodynamic studies on effect of single dose and 2-weeks continuous oral enalapril in patients with heart failure

Abstract
Clinical and hemodynamic studies were carried out with the purpose of evaluating the effects of enalapril in the treatment of chronic heart failure. Enalapril 10—20 mg was given once a day to 10 patients with moderate to severe congestive heart failure(coronary 6,hypertensive heart disease 2 and idiopathic congestive cardiomyopathy.). Hemodynamic studies were done on the first day after drug administration,the same daily dose was maitained for 2 weeks. The results showed a 18.29% decrease in mean BP(p<0.01),40.4% in CVP,23.9% in mPAP,41.2% in PCWP,39.9% and 41.3% in SVR and PVR respectively(P<0.001).Cardiac index increased 44.16%(P<0.001).The theraputic action maintained and lasted for more than 24 hours by one dose.No further drop of BP 2 weeks later.Six patients primarily in NYHA class Ⅲ and 2 in Class Ⅳ improved to class Ⅱ.No severe side effects were found. The results showed that enalapril was well tolerated in single dose as well as in 2 weeks continous therapy,showing both hemodynamic and subjective sympton improvement.
